The HGV AI driver camera is a cutting-edge system that combines AI technology with high-definition cameras to monitor a driver’s behavior and the surrounding environment. These cameras are strategically placed inside the cab of the truck and around the exterior to capture a comprehensive view of the road and the driver. By analyzing the data collected by these cameras, the AI system can detect various behaviors and situations that can impact safety on the road.
One of the primary functions of the HGV AI driver camera is to monitor the driver’s behavior. The AI system can detect signs of fatigue, distraction, or impairment, such as drowsiness, texting while driving, or operating the vehicle under the influence of drugs or alcohol. By alerting the driver or the fleet manager to these risky behaviors, the camera can prevent accidents and save lives.
Moreover, the AI system can also monitor other aspects of the driver’s performance, such as adherence to traffic laws and company policies. For instance, the camera can detect instances of speeding, tailgating, or improper lane changes. By providing real-time feedback to the driver, the HGV AI driver camera can encourage safer driving practices and reduce the risk of collisions.
In addition to monitoring the driver, the HGV AI driver camera is also equipped with features that enhance situational awareness on the road. The cameras capture a 360-degree view of the surroundings, allowing the AI system to detect potential hazards, such as pedestrians, cyclists, or other vehicles in blind spots. By alerting the driver to these dangers, the camera can help prevent accidents and ensure the safety of everyone on the road.
Furthermore, the HGV AI driver camera can also record footage of incidents on the road, such as accidents or near-misses. This video evidence can be invaluable in determining the cause of an incident and assigning liability. In the event of a collision, the camera can provide clear, objective documentation of what occurred, helping to expedite the claims process and resolve disputes more efficiently.

Despite the numerous advantages of the HGV AI driver camera, some concerns have been raised about privacy and data security. As these cameras are constantly monitoring the driver’s behavior and the surrounding environment, there is a risk that sensitive information could be captured and misused. To address these concerns, manufacturers of HGV AI driver cameras have implemented stringent security measures, such as encryption, data anonymization, and restricted access to the footage.
